R R Kabel Limited IPO: All you need to know

The initial public offering (IPO) for R R Kabel Limited is set to open for subscription from 13 September 2023 to 15 September 2023. The set IPO price range is Rs. ₹983 to ₹1035 per share with a face value of ₹5 each.
The EMS IPO has a lot size of 14 shares with a minimum investment of ₹14,490. The listing date of the IPO is 26 September 2023 (expected). The total IPO size is ₹ 1,964 Crores, including a ₹180 Crore fresh issue and ₹1784 crore Offer-for-Sale (OFS)
R R Kabel Limited IPO: Business Overview
Incorporated in 1995, R R Kabel Limited provides consumer electrical products used for residential, commercial, industrial, and infrastructure purposes.
RR Kabel ranks as a foremost entity in India's wire, cable, and FMEG sectors, boasting the fifth-largest production volume and a 5% market footprint.
Nestled in Gujarat and Daman & Diu, RR Kabel's dual facilities cater to wire and cable production. Additionally, three FMEG-centric hubs operate across Uttarakhand, Karnataka, and Himachal Pradesh.
A sprawling network of 106,626 retailers bolsters its manufacturing reach, while 35 global certifications fortify its reputation. Delving into its offerings, RR Kabel crafts an array of electrical commodities, with wires and cables accounting for 71% of revenue and the residual 29% from FMEG items, primarily B2C.

Axis Capital Limited and Citigroup Global Markets India Private Limited have been appointed as the book-running lead managers for the R R Kabel Limited IPO, while Link Intime India Private Limited will serve as the registrar to the issue. The shares are expected to be listed on both BSE and NSE, with a tentative listing date of September 26, which falls on a Tuesday.
The objective of the issue:
The company plans to allocate the issue's net proceeds to fund the subsequent objectives:
- Repayment or prepayment, in full or in part, of borrowings availed by the company from banks and financial institutions.
- General corporate purposes.

R R Kabel Limited IPO: Strengths
- The firm offers diverse products, fostering cross-sales. They tap into global trends, meeting demands for 5G cables, EV chargers, smart fans, and unique lighting.
- The company leads its Indian peers in growth with a 43.4% CAGR from FY21 to FY23 and actively markets its brand and products across various customer touchpoints.
- The company foresees capturing significant FMEG market growth with its omnichannel strategy, diverse product range, varied pricing, and knack for spotting segment gaps.
- The company runs five manufacturing sites, is globally accredited, adept at crafting its diverse product line.
- The company has a pan-India distribution network and also a global distribution network that helps it maximize its customer reach.
R R Kabel Limited IPO: Risks
- The company faces risks from foreign currency shifts, impacting imports, exports, and borrowings, which could harm its financial performance.
- The company uses bank channel financing to boost cash flow and guarantee some customer debts. Non-repayment by customers could hurt its profits.
- The company's high power needs mean disruptions could raise production costs, impacting its operations and cash flows.
- Counterfeit goods and trademark breaches could weaken the company's competitive stance.
- The company might struggle to clinch favorable deals with global distributors. Losing major overseas partners could severely impact its business and financial health.
